According to the Lines Perpendicular to a Transversal Theorem, lines that are perpendicular to the same line are parallel to each other.


Let's first look at a and b. These lines are both perpendicular to n so therefore, a and b have to be parallel.

Other than that, there are no more lines where we know they are parallel.
